Lets compare vitamin content per 14 ounces of Whole Soft Wheat Flour vs Refined Sorghum Flour:
Soft Wheat Whole Grain Flour has 3.3 times more Vitamin B1, 37.6 times more Vitamin B2, 4 times more Vitamin B3, 5.5 times more Vitamin B5 and 2.8 times more Vitamin B6 than Refined Unenriched Sorghum Flour.
Both Soft Wheat Whole Grain Flour as well as Refined Unenriched Sorghum Flour have insufficient amounts of Vitamin C in 14 oz.
Comparing minerals per 14 ounces for Whole Soft Wheat Flour vs Refined Sorghum Flour:
Soft Wheat Whole Grain Flour has 5.5 times more Calcium, 52.8 times more Copper, 3.8 times more Iron, 3.8 times more Magnesium, 7.9 times more Manganese, 3.7 times more Phosphorus, 2.7 times more Potassium and 6.3 times more Zinc than Refined Unenriched Sorghum Flour.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 14 ounces:
Soft Wheat Whole Grain Flour has 1.6 times more Fat, 1.4 times more Saturated Fat and 6.9 times more Fiber than Refined Unenriched Sorghum Flour.
Both Soft Wheat Whole Grain Flour and Refined Unenriched Sorghum Flour have similar amounts of Energy, Carbohydrate and Protein per 14 oz.
Both Soft Wheat Whole Grain Flour as well as Refined Unenriched Sorghum Flour have insufficient amounts of Glucose and Sucrose in 14 oz.
